Repel repels pokemon below the leading pokemon's level.
Since the Pidgey is at a lower level than Drowzee (you got the levels wrong, didn't you?), the Drowsee won't be repelled.
Since the Nidoking is at a higher level than Entei, Entei was repeled.
It's really that simple!
